On Tue, 2007-11-20 at 15:01 -0600, Kumar Gala wrote:
> > Given that the instruction is meant to be a performance enhancement,
> > we should probably warn the first few times it's emulated, so the
> user
> > knows they should change their toolchain setup if possible.
> 
> The same is true of mcrxr, popcntb, and possibly string ld/st.
> 
> Feel free to submit a patch that warns about their usage.

At least we should keep counters... best would be per-task counters
in /proc but that sounds harder :-)

I remember in the early days of powerpc, it wasn't uncommon to have apps
with issues because they used 601 only bits on 603/4 that had to be
emulated (such as old POWER opcodes). On MacOS, we used to have a
system-wide counter of the number of emulated instructions we could use
to detect these things.
